TDA2030A Audio Amplifier
The TDA2030A is a monolithic integrated circuit, available in a Pentawatt package, designed for use as a low-frequency class-AB audio amplifier. This powerful IC is capable of delivering up to 18 watts of output power, making it an excellent choice for a variety of audio applications. It is particularly well-suited for driving 4Ω speakers at 12W or 8Ω speakers at 8W. The TDA2030A is known for its high output current and very low harmonic and crossover distortion, ensuring clean and accurate sound reproduction. For added reliability, it incorporates short-circuit and thermal protection.

Specifications
| Parameter | Test Conditions | Min. | Typ. | Max. | Unit |
|---|---|---|---|---|---|
| Supply Voltage (VS) | ±6 | ±22 | V | ||
| Output Power (PO) | d = 0.5%, GV = 26dB, RL = 4Ω | 15 | 18 | W | |
| d = 0.5%, GV = 26dB, RL = 8Ω | 10 | 12 | W | ||
| Quiescent Drain Current (Id) | 50 | 80 | mA | ||
| Input Bias Current (Ib) | VS = ±22V | 0.2 | 2 | µA | |
| Input Offset Voltage (Vos) | VS = ±22V | ±2 | ±20 | mV | |
| Input Offset Current (Ios) | ±20 | ±200 | nA | ||
| Total Harmonic Distortion (d) | PO = 0.1 to 14W, RL = 4Ω, f = 1kHz | 0.03 | % | ||
| Open Loop Voltage Gain (Gv) | f = 1kHz | 80 | dB | ||
| Closed Loop Voltage Gain (Gv) | f = 1kHz | 25.5 | 26 | 26.5 | dB |
| Slew Rate (SR) | 8 | V/µsec | |||
| Power Bandwidth (BW) | PO = 15W, RL = 4Ω | 100 | kHz | ||
| Thermal Resistance Junction-case (Rth j-case) | 3 | °C/W |
